horizon_min horizon_max: two spherical angles, defining portion of sphere to emit light from. Default is 0 90, which is upper hemisphere. -90 90 will be whole sphere. sample_color: Default = 1: sample color of each individual light from skybox images, if they are present. 0: use shader color, set by q3map_lightRGB/q3map_lightImage/_up skybox image/qer_editorImage. * q3map_skylight may be used multiple times in a single shader
